Mutations in KCND3 cause spinocerebellar ataxia type 22.
Annals of neurology - 1 Dec 2012
Lee Yi-Chung, Durr Alexandra, Majczenko Karen, Huang Yen-Hua, Liu Yu-Chao, Lien Cheng-Chang, Tsai Pei-Chien, Ichikawa Yaeko, Goto Jun, Monin Marie-Lorraine, Li Jun Z, Chung Ming-Yi, Mundwiller Emeline, Shakkottai Vikram, Liu Tze-Tze, Tesson Christelle, Lu Yi-Chun, Brice Alexis, Tsuji Shoji, Burmeister Margit, Stevanin Giovanni, Soong Bing-Wen
Abstract excerpt
OBJECTIVE: To identify the causative gene in spinocerebellar ataxia (SCA) 22, an autosomal dominant cerebellar ataxia mapped to chromosome 1p21-q23. METHODS: We previously characterized a large Chinese family with progressive ataxia designated SCA22, which overlaps with the locus of SCA19. The disease locus in a French family and an Ashkenazi Jewish American family was also mapped to this region. Members from all...
